    Finding Cricket Live Score APIs on GitHub

    Alright, now that you're pumped about the power of APIs, let's find one! GitHub is a fantastic place to start your search for cricket live score APIs. It's a goldmine of open-source projects, and you're likely to find many options. To kick things off, search GitHub using keywords like 'cricket API', 'cricket live scores', or 'cricket data API'. You’ll see a bunch of repositories pop up, each offering a different way to access cricket data. When you're browsing the search results, it's essential to look at a few key things. First, check the project's documentation. Good documentation tells you how to use the API, what data it provides, and how to format your requests. If the documentation is unclear or missing, you might want to move on to another option.

    Next, look at the popularity of the repository. Check the number of stars, forks, and the last time the code was updated. More stars and forks usually indicate a more active and well-maintained project. Also, an actively maintained project is more likely to provide up-to-date and reliable data. Consider the license of the project too. Different licenses have different terms of use. Make sure the license suits your needs, especially if you plan to use the API for commercial purposes. Don't be afraid to dig deeper. Take a look at the code itself. Understanding the code can give you a good idea of how the API works and the quality of the data. Look for issues and pull requests too. These can provide valuable insights into the project's development and any potential problems. Now, the final step involves actually testing the API. Get the example code and test the API endpoints to make sure they work and deliver the data in the format you expect. Testing early on can save you a lot of headaches down the line. By paying close attention to these points, you can make sure to find the best API for your project and get started the right way.

    Key Features to Look for in a Cricket Live Scores API

    Okay, you've found a few cricket live scores APIs on GitHub, but how do you decide which one's the best for you? Let's break down the essential features to look for. One of the most important things is real-time data. Make sure the API provides up-to-the-minute updates. Look for APIs that refresh scores frequently, ideally with minimal delay. This is a non-negotiable feature for live score applications. Next, make sure the API offers comprehensive data coverage. Does it cover all the major cricket tournaments and leagues worldwide? Consider the format of cricket as well, like Test matches, ODIs, and T20s. The more coverage the API has, the better.

    Another crucial aspect is the data format. Is the data easy to understand and use? APIs often return data in JSON or XML format. Ensure the structure is clean, well-organized, and compatible with your project. Well-structured data will save you loads of time and make integration easier. Consider the API endpoints available. Does the API offer endpoints for all the data you need? This might include match schedules, player stats, team rankings, ball-by-ball commentary, and more. Make sure it provides all the data points you need for your project. Don't forget about data reliability. Check if the API is known for providing accurate and consistent data. Look for reviews or testimonials from other users. Also, check the API's track record for uptime. Finally, consider rate limits and usage policies. Most APIs have limits on how frequently you can make requests. Understand these limits to prevent disruptions in your app. Some APIs might require an API key or have a specific pricing plan, so you need to be aware of the cost and restrictions before use. Choosing the right API with the right features will help you create a quality project.

    Implementing a Cricket Live Score API: A Step-by-Step Guide

    Alright, you've found your cricket live scores API, now let's get down to business and implement it! Here's a step-by-step guide to help you integrate the API into your project.

    First, you will need to get a hold of the API authentication. Many APIs require an API key to track your usage and manage access. Sign up for an account on the API provider's website and obtain your API key. Keep this key safe and secure. Next, you need to set up your development environment. This might involve installing any necessary libraries or packages, like a library to make HTTP requests (e.g., requests in Python). Make sure your environment is ready to handle API calls and data processing. The next stage involves making your API calls. Use the documentation to identify the API endpoints you need to access and construct the appropriate requests. For example, you might use a GET request to retrieve live scores. Remember to include your API key in the request headers or parameters. After making the API request, you will receive data, usually in JSON format. Then, you'll need to parse the API response. Use a JSON parsing library (most programming languages have one built-in) to extract the data you need. For example, you can get the current score, the players involved, and the over count.

    Next, you will process and display the data. Once you've parsed the data, format it in a way that's easy to read and use in your application. This might involve creating tables, charts, or other visual elements to present the cricket data to your users. Consider building a user interface to display the real-time information. Furthermore, don't forget to handle errors and exceptions. API calls can sometimes fail, so it's critical to handle errors gracefully. Use try-except blocks to catch any exceptions and provide informative error messages to your users. Finally, test and debug your implementation. Test your code thoroughly to make sure the API data is displayed accurately. Check for any issues or unexpected behavior. Use debugging tools to identify and fix any problems. By following these steps, you'll be well on your way to incorporating live cricket scores into your project.

    Common Challenges and Troubleshooting Tips

    Alright, let's talk about some of the common challenges you might face when working with a Cricket Live Scores API and how to overcome them. Dealing with rate limits is a really common issue. APIs often have limits on the number of requests you can make within a certain time frame. Exceeding these limits can lead to your application being temporarily blocked. To avoid this, carefully manage your request frequency. Implement delays or use caching to reduce the number of requests. If your app will be making a lot of requests, consider a paid plan with higher limits. Next up, is data inconsistency. Sometimes, APIs can provide inconsistent or inaccurate data. This could be due to issues with the source data or problems with the API itself. To mitigate this, check the API's documentation and monitor the API's performance. Consider using multiple APIs and comparing the data to ensure accuracy.

    Another common challenge is dealing with API changes. APIs evolve over time. They are updated, and sometimes the structure of the data changes. This can break your code if you are not careful. Always stay updated with API updates and changes. Monitor the API's documentation regularly. Update your code to accommodate any structural changes. You will need to handle error responses. API requests can fail for various reasons, such as network issues or invalid requests. Your code should be robust enough to handle error responses. Implement error handling. Use try-except blocks to catch API errors. Provide informative error messages to the user. Finally, consider security. If your application requires authentication, make sure you securely store and handle your API keys. Never hardcode API keys directly into your code. Use environment variables or configuration files to store sensitive information. By knowing these common challenges in advance, you can save yourself a lot of headache and get back to enjoying the game!
